On Wed, Jul 20, 2005 at 03:38:02PM +0200, Jesper Juhl wrote:
>...
> I send a patch for this yesterday that lets SCSI_QLA2XXX select
> FW_LOADER. I believe that's a bit better since the other options
> depend on SCSI_QLA2XXX anyway, there's no point in having them all set
> FW_LOADER. My patch also fixes another little issue; that you cannot
> disable SCSI_QLA2XXX if you don't need it.
>...
That's not an issue, this seems to be intentional.
Whether SCSI_QLA2XXX should be user-visible (as your patches make it) or
stay as it is (with the fixes from my patches) doesn't matter much -
both are valid setups.
